The Governor of the Bank of Ghana (BoG), Dr Ernest Addison, has justified the GHS10.5 billion losses it incurred in 2023.
He defined that the loss was much like experiences of some central banks throughout the globe, which resulted from the price incurred in delivering on their main mandate
of value stability.
This is contained within the foreword to the BOG’s 2023 Annual Report and Financial Statement.
Mr Addison mentioned the loss didn’t have an effect on the central financial institution’s total operations.
